- Written Answers — Department of Education and Skills: Pupil-Teacher Ratio (24 Feb 2015)
Jan O'Sullivan: The criteria used for the allocation of teaching posts is published annually on the Department website. The key factor for determining the level of staffing resources provided at individual school level is the staffing schedule for the relevant school year and pupil enrolments on the previous 30 September. - Written Answers — Department of Education and Skills: Home Tuition Scheme Eligibility (24 Feb 2015)
Jan O'Sullivan: The Deputy will be aware that the purpose of the Home Tuition Scheme is to provide a compensatory educational service for children who, for a number of reasons such as chronic illness, are unable to attend school. - Written Answers — Department of Education and Skills: Teaching Qualifications (24 Feb 2015)
Jan O'Sullivan: Under the Teaching Council Act 2001, the Teaching Council is, since March 2006, the regulator and standards body for the teaching profession. Accordingly, it holds authority and responsibility for registration of teachers in the State.
